How much do remote network cyber security jobs pay per year?

As of May 30, 2026, the average yearly pay for remote network cyber security in the United States is $122,890.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$102,000.00 and $142,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Remote Network Cyber Security vs Remote Network Security Analyst?

AspectRemote Network Cyber SecurityRemote Network Security Analyst
CertificationsCompTIA Security+, CISSP, CEHCompTIA Security+, CISSP, CEH
Work EnvironmentDesigning, implementing, and monitoring security measures for networks remotelyMonitoring network security, analyzing threats, and responding to incidents remotely
Employer & Industry UsageIT security firms, large corporations, government agenciesIT departments, cybersecurity firms, enterprise organizations

Remote Network Cyber Security professionals focus on designing and implementing security solutions for networks remotely, while Remote Network Security Analysts primarily monitor and analyze network security threats and respond to incidents. Both roles require similar certifications and often work in similar environments, but their core responsibilities differ in scope and focus.

Company website: https://www.inkit.com Cyber Security Engineer We are looking to hire a cyber security engineer (SkillBridge Intern) with an analytical mind and a detailed meticulous attention to detail, outstanding problem-solving skills, work comfortably under pressure, and deliver on tight deadlines. To ensure success, a cyber security engineer must display an excellent understanding of technology infrastructures using Firewalls, VPN, Data Loss Prevention, IDS/IPS, Web-Proxy, and Security Audits

Top candidates will be comfortable working with a variety of technologies, security problems, and troubleshooting of the network. Cyber Security Engineer Responsibilities include but are not limited to: Planning, implementing, managing, monitoring, and upgrading security measures for the protection of the organization's data, systems, and networks. Troubleshooting security and network problems.

Responding to all system and/or network security breaches. Ensuring that the organization's data and infrastructure are protected by enabling the appropriate security controls. Participating in the change management process.

Testing and identifying network and system vulnerabilities. Daily administrative tasks, reporting, and communication with the relevant departments in the organization. Cyber Security Engineer Requirements: A degree in computer science, IT, systems engineering, or related qualification.

2 years of work experience with incident detection, incident response, and forensics. Experience with Firewalls (functionality and maintenance), Office 365 Security, VSX, and Endpoint Security. Proficiency in Python, C++, Java, Ruby, Node, Go, and/or Power Shell.

Ability to work under pressure in a fast-paced environment. Strong attention to detail with an analytical mind and outstanding problem-solving skills. Great awareness of cybersecurity trends and hacking techniques.
